A disco ball is shaped like a sphere with a diameter of 16 inches to the nearest square inch what is the surface area of the disco ball

    The surface area of a sphere:

    A = 4 pi r^2

    where pi = 3.1416

    r is the radius

    since diameter is given

    r = d / 2

    r = 16 / 2

    r = 8

    A = 4 pi (8^2)

    A = 804 sq in is the surface area of the disco ball
